Mājas lapa » » Kā izveidot pielāgotus tastatūras īsceļus ar AutoHotkey

    Kā izveidot pielāgotus tastatūras īsceļus ar AutoHotkey

    Ir dažas lietas, kas ir tikai sāpes, lai ievadītu, it īpaši, ja tās jāievada vairāk un vairāk. Vai pat vēl sliktāk, ja tie, ko vēlaties ierakstīt, klaviatūrā nepastāv. Ko jūs darāt, ja lietojat amerikāņu tastatūru, un jums ir jāiesniedz € dokumentā?

    Man bija šī problēma. Es biju satraukts, un vēl ļaunāk, es izdarīju kļūdas. Man bija nepieciešams, lai ierobežotu savu neērtību un pārliecinieties, ka šīs monotoniskās lietas, kuras man bija jāievada atkārtoti, bija konsekventas un pareizas. Medības tika risinātas. Izrādās, ka ir viena atbilde uz abām problēmām: AutoHotKey.

    Kas ir AutoHotkey?

    Savā kodolā AutoHotkey (AHK) ir skriptu platforma. Tikai ar nelielu "koda" bitu var izveidot skriptu, kas darbojas fonā un ļauj jums darīt gandrīz visu ar iestatīto taustiņu. Ja ir tastatūras īsceļš, kuru vēlaties mainīt, varat to pārtaisīt. Ja ir frāze, kuru regulāri ierakstāt, var piešķirt tai kombināciju. Ja ir vairākas komandas, kuras manuāli darbināt regulāri, AHK var tos visus darbināt ar vienkāršu taustiņu kombināciju.

    Neskatieties uz vārdiem, piemēram, “skriptu platforma” un “kods”. AutoHotkey ir ļoti vienkārši, lai sāktu darbu, it īpaši, ja jūs vienkārši piešķirat pamata taustiņus pamata komandām. Iespējams, jūs varat uzzināt, kas jums ir nepieciešams vienas pēcpusdienas laikā. Ejam cauri dažiem pamata piemēriem, ko AutoHotkey var darīt, lai sāktu darbu.

    Kā instalēt AutoHotkey

    Noklikšķiniet uz AutoHotkey tīmekļa vietnes, lai lejupielādētu programmu. Galvenajā lapā ir liela zaļa poga, kas norāda uz “Lejupielādēt”. Uzklikšķinot uz tā, jūs nonāksit lejupielādes lapā. Šeit varat noklikšķināt uz plīsuma lejupielādes pogas, lai iegūtu jaunāko versiju.

    PIEZĪME. Dažas pretvīrusu programmas atzīmēs AutoHotkey kā ļaunprātīgu programmatūru. Tas ir viltus pozitīvs. AutoHotkey ir ārkārtīgi spēcīgs, un, lai gan tas pats par sevi nav bīstams, tas ir skriptu valoda, kas nozīmē, ka jūs varētu izveidot ļaunprātīgu programmatūru, ja jums būtu vēlme. Bet neuztraucieties par to, ka lejupielādējat pašu bāzes programmu AutoHotkey; tas nekaitēs jūsu datoram.

    Kad instalācijas fails ir lejupielādēts, veiciet dubultklikšķi uz tā, lai sāktu instalēt AutoHotkey. Gandrīz visi lietotāji vēlas izmantot Express uzstādīšanas pogu. Pielāgota instalēšana dod iespēju izvēlēties noklusējuma uzvedību un instalēt atrašanās vietu. Vislabāk ir atstāt noklusējuma iestatījumus.

    Kad tas ir instalēts, jūs esat gatavs nokļūt jautrībā: rakstot pirmo skriptu.

    Kā izveidot savu pirmo AutoHotkey skriptu

    Lietojumprogrammas AutoHotkey palaišana tagad faktiski neko nedarīs, bet palaiž tās palīdzības lapu. Lai sāktu darbu, jums ir nepieciešams skripts, kas paziņo AutoHotkey par pielāgotajiem tastatūras īsceļiem. Tāpēc sāksim, izveidojot vienu.

    Ar peles labo pogu noklikšķiniet uz darbvirsmas (vai jebkuras citas mapes) un izvēlieties Jauns> Automātiskā taustiņa skripts. Tas izveidos jaunu failu ar paplašinājumu .ahk šajā mapē. Nosauciet vajadzīgo failu, pēc tam ar peles labo pogu noklikšķiniet uz tā un atveriet to Notepad. (vai, ja jums ir vēl vairāk kodi draudzīga programma, piemēram, Notepad ++). Failā būs kāds teksts. Vienkāršiem skriptiem, kas šeit bija demonstrēti, to var noņemt. Kad jūs saņemsiet vairāk uzlabojumu, jūs varat atstāt to.

    Jums tiks piešķirts gandrīz tukšs šīferis, lai izveidotu jūsu sapņu īsinājumtaustiņus. Šeit ir daži piemēri.

    Sāksim ar īstu vienkāršu rakstzīmju ievadīšanas skriptu. Man ir skripts, ko izmantoju katru dienu, lai ļautu man rakstīt no vācu valodas, kas nav manā angļu tastatūrā. Pieņemsim, ka es gribu rakstīt ß rakstzīmi, kad es nospiežu Alt + Shift + S uz tastatūras. Automātiskajā atslēgā tas izskatās šādi:

    !+s :: Sūtīt, ß

    Sadalīsim šo teksta daļu:

    • ! ir Alt taustiņa simbols
    • + ir Shift taustiņa simbols
    • s apzīmē (acīmredzami) S taustiņu
    • :: apzīmē to, ko vēlaties, lai pirms taustiņi darbotos, kad tie tiek piespiesti kopā
    • Sūtīt ir komanda, kas ieraksta procesa tekstu
    • ß ir teksts, kuru mēs vēlamies komandai.

    Būtībā šī komanda saka: “Vienlaicīgi nospiežot Alt, Shift un S, ierakstiet ß.”

    Varat pievienot arī citus modifikatorus. Piemēram, ja pievienojat < symbol before your hotkey (so it reads , varat pasūtīt AutoHotkey komandu tikai tad, ja tiek izmantots kreisais Alt taustiņš.

    Mans viss Vācijas simbolu karsto taustiņu skripts izskatās šādi:

     

    Ja zināt to rakstzīmi, kuru vēlaties pievienot savam skriptam, iespējams, ka to meklējot Google, ir ātrākais veids, kā to atrast. Ja tā nav, varat to meklēt ASCII vai Unicode tabulā.

    To var ņemt tālāk par atsevišķām rakstzīmēm. Ja jūs atrodaties regulāri, cenšoties pārvērst sarežģītas, nepatīkamas vai vienkārši garas rakstzīmes no jūsu smadzenēm uz pirkstiem, AutoHotkey ir jūsu jaunais labākais draugs. Manā citā darbā man bieži ir jāvēršas pie personām citās iestādēs, lai apspriestu projektu drošības elementus bez jebkādas ievadīšanas no cilvēkiem, ar kuriem es strādāju. Tas prasa man paskaidrot, kas es esmu un kāpēc es ar viņiem sazinājos. Tā vietā, lai ierakstītu šo visu ziņojumu, es izmantoju karstumu AHK. Skripts izskatās šādi:

    The : *: sākumā stāsta AHK, lai tā skatītos uz to, kas seko tai. Šajā gadījumā šī virkne ir ncm (īss par “jaunu auksto ziņojumu” manā galvā). Tātad, jebkurā laikā ierakstot burtus ncm, tas mainīs tos ar sekojošo teksta virkni :: skriptu. Man ir ne tikai pagriezusi punktu, kas ir vērts ievadīt trīs taustiņsitienus, bet es zinu, ka tas būs pareizs katru reizi.

    To var paveikt ar karsto taustiņu, nevis hotscript. Jūs varētu aizstāt : *: ncm skriptu ar !+n un jums ir tāda pati teksta virkne, ar kuru jūs nospiežat Alt + N tastatūrā.

    AutoHotkey ir arī spējīgs no datora uzvilkt pamata informāciju. Piemēram, tas var saņemt šodienas datumu. Tātad, ja jūs esat kāds, kurš ieraksta datumu daudzās jomās, šis skripts varētu būt glābējs.

    Ja palaižat šo skriptu, AutoHotkey atcels pašreizējo datumu jebkurā kursorā. Jūs varat spēlēt ar lietām, piemēram, formatējumu (piemēram, dd / MM / gggg, salīdzinot ar MM / dd / gggg) skriptos..

    Turpinot: Palaist programmas, Remap saīsnes un vairāk

    AutoHotkey var izdarīt daudz vairāk, nekā ievietot tekstu (lai gan tas ir viens no biežāk lietotajiem). Varat arī to izmantot, lai palaistu programmu, nospiežot noteiktu taustiņu, pārtaisot īsceļus, piemēram, Alt + Tab, lai izvēlētos izvēlētos taustiņus, vai noņemtu peles pogas. Ja jums ir patiešām dziļi, jūs varat pat izveidot dialoglodziņus vai pilnvērtīgas programmas ar AutoHotkey.

    Automātiskās atslēgas dokumentācijā var redzēt dažādus karsto taustiņu simbolus. Jūs varat arī redzēt savu iesācēju pamācību, lai iegūtu vēl vairāk piemēru, ko varat darīt skriptu. Ja jums kādreiz ir iestrēdzis, AutoHotkey forums ir lieliska vieta, kur meklēt, uzdot jautājumus un uzzināt vairāk par to, ko AutoHotkey var izdarīt.